Sun illuminates the mound at Newgrange. The Megalithic Passage Tombs of Newgrange. Are located in the present day County Meath in Irelands Ancient East. The Boyne Valley Mounds at Newgrange, Knowth and Dowth were built around 3200BC making them older than Stonehenge. In England and the Pyramids of Giza in Egypt. Built by Neolithic farming communities about 5000 years ago, the passage tombs have clear astronomical alignments such as the Winter Solstice Sunrise. At Newgrange and the Equinox Sunrise.

Broch, Crannog and Hillfort. Wednesday, February 28, 2018. Wednesday, January 31, 2018. Axe-like wood-working tool, but with blade at right-angles to the handle, used with pick-like motion. A pointed tool of flint, bone or bronze, used for making holes in skins, etc. An earthen burial mound, either circular or rectangular in plan. Engraving or piercing tool, used with rotary action. Flat platform separating a mound or bank from a quarry ditch.
